Odin: Valhalla Rising Heats Up with Massive Summer Content Drop

Kakao Games’ popular Norse-inspired MMORPG, Odin: Valhalla Rising, just launched its summer update, packing in new dungeons, stylish outfits, and fresh features. This update is available now, bringing the heat after leaving winter behind.

What is coming in Odin: Valhalla Rising’s Shadow Fortress Update?

Prepare for intense cooperative gameplay in the new Shadow Fortress elite dungeon. This challenging zone will push even the strongest guilds to their limits as they strive to conquer the final boss and obtain legendary-grade items. You can also acquire materials for the new “Imprint” system here, helping you achieve even greater power.

Adding to the challenge, the Shadow Fortress is a player-kill-enabled zone. Unlike other areas, players can eliminate each other without incurring penalties. The darkness intensifies the difficulty, as no names are displayed on screen, making it impossible to distinguish a friend from a foe.

Additionally, a refreshing, summer resort-themed event dungeon, Summer Island, is now open for four weeks. Defeating monsters here grants event items, including the Summer Party Scroll, which players can exchange for the Summer Party Skin Ticket. Each character boasts four summer-style outfits, available for a limited time from June 26 to July 30.

A login reward event is also underway as part of this update, offering players up to 77 summon tickets and a variety of other items.

Key Features of Odin: Valhalla Rising’s Shadow Fortress Update

  • Embark on an epic adventure as one of four class types: Warrior, Sorceress, Priest, and Rogue.
  • Explore a vast, open world inspired by Norse mythology. Enjoy uninterrupted exploration on mobile or PC, with no loading screens outside of instanced dungeons.
  • Take on the new Shadow Fortress dungeon for a chance to obtain legendary items, if you can survive the darkness.
  • Beat the heat with new summer-themed cosmetics and the Summer Island event dungeon, open for a limited time.

Odin: Valhalla Rising is free on PC and mobile with crossplay support. Dive into the summer content today.
